Independent Living in Winthrop
Winthrop’s scenic shoreline and easy MBTA access make independent living ideal for seniors who want to stay active without home maintenance. Thoughtful floorplans, safety features, and vibrant social life surround you, with nearby shops, parks, and waterfront activities along the coast.
Assisted Living in Winthrop
Assisted living in Winthrop provides help with daily tasks, medication management, and around-the-clock staff, while preserving independence. Local care teams coordinate with nearby hospitals such as Massachusetts General Hospital and Brigham and Women's for easy access to medical services.
Memory Care in Winthrop
Memory care in Winthrop focuses on safety, structured routines, and engaging activities tailored to memory needs. Specialized staff, secure environments, and connections to the broader Boston medical community help residents stay engaged and supported.
Skilled Nursing in Winthrop
Skilled nursing in Winthrop offers comprehensive rehab, long-term medical support, and coordinated care plans. On-site nursing and therapy services work with regional hospitals to provide family-centered care in a supportive, coastal setting.

Cost of Senior Living in Winthrop
Winthrop sits in the Greater Boston region, where senior living costs reflect the metro’s mix of services and housing types. Independent living commonly ranges around a few thousand dollars monthly, with assisted living, memory care, and skilled nursing priced higher based on care level and apartment size. Costs vary by included services and location.
Generally in line with nearby coastal communities and the Greater Boston area; costs can be slightly higher than some inland areas due to metro access and regional pricing.
Key Cost Factors in Winthrop
- care level (independent, assistive, memory care, skilled nursing)
- apartment size and layout
- location within Winthrop (waterfront vs inland)
- included services (meals, transportation, housekeeping)
- availability and duration of care needs

What should I consider when selecting assisted care facilities near me in Winthrop?
Consider staff-to-resident ratios, availability of 24-hour assistance, emergency call systems, meal plans, transportation options, and transparency in pricing. Schedule in-person tours, ask for references, and compare services included in monthly rates to avoid hidden fees.
Are memory care services available in the Winthrop area?
Yes, memory care options exist in the Greater Boston area. Look for facilities with secure environments, trained staff, structured daily routines, and coordination with local hospitals and specialists to support medical and cognitive needs.
What is the first step to start senior home care near me in Winthrop?
Assess needs with family and a clinician, research nearby providers, gather medical records, and contact a local senior care advisor. Schedule an in-home assessment to determine care levels, and request a clear, written comparison of services and pricing.
